What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Volunteer Accountant,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Volunteer Accountant, you need a solid understanding of accounting principles, bookkeeping, and financial reporting, often supported by relevant coursework or experience. Familiarity with accounting software like QuickBooks or Excel, and sometimes knowledge of nonprofit accounting systems, is typically required. Strong attention to detail, reliability, and effective communication are standout soft skills for this role. These competencies ensure accurate financial management and transparency, which are critical for supporting the mission and operations of volunteer-driven organizations.

What types of tasks can I expect to handle as a volunteer accountant, and how do these differ from paid accounting roles?

As a volunteer accountant, you’ll typically manage tasks such as bookkeeping, preparing financial statements, assisting with budgeting, and ensuring compliance with relevant regulations for nonprofit organizations. Unlike paid accounting roles, you may work more independently or in smaller teams, and often need to adapt to varied record-keeping systems or limited resources. Volunteer roles also offer a chance to collaborate closely with program staff and board members, providing insights that can directly support the organization’s mission. This experience can enhance your professional skills while allowing you to make a meaningful impact in your community.

What is volunteer accounting?

Volunteer accounting involves providing accounting or bookkeeping services on a voluntary, unpaid basis, often for nonprofit organizations, community groups, or charities. Volunteers help with tasks such as recording financial transactions, preparing budgets, reconciling bank statements, and generating financial reports. Their work ensures that organizations maintain accurate financial records and meet regulatory requirements. This role is critical for nonprofits that may not have the resources to hire professional accountants.

Job description

SUMMARY/OBJECTIVE
The Accounting Manager leads a team of Senior and Staff Accountants responsible for accurate, timely, and compliant financial reporting across designated business units or functional areas. This role manages all phases of the accounting cycle, including journal entries, account reconciliations, and month-end close activities, ensuring adherence to corporate accounting standards. The Accounting Manager collaborates with Corporate Accounting leadership and cross-functional teams to maintain consistency across processes, resolve complex accounting matters, and drive continuous improvement within the organization.
Essential Functions
  • Lead and develop an assigned accounting team, including Senior and Staff Accountants, by managing workload priorities, ensuring accuracy and timeliness, and promoting continuous improvement in accounting processes.
  • Manage and perform accounting activities for designated business units or functions, ensuring completeness, accuracy, and compliance with corporate accounting standards.
  • Oversee the month-end close for assigned entities or divisions including reviewing journal entries, validating P&L statements, and ensuring all balance sheet accounts are reconciled and supported.
  • Present financial results and performance analyses to Corporate Accounting leadership, providing clear insight into trends, variances, and underlying business drivers.
  • Serve as the primary accounting contact for assigned business units or processes, partnering with leadership, FP&A, and Operations to ensure alignment and accuracy in financial reporting.
  • Oversee transactional accounting processes within area of responsibility, maintaining compliance with policy.
  • Develop and maintain reporting and performance metrics for high-volume or complex accounting areas to enhance visibility, accuracy, and control.
  • Maintain and update corporate accounting policies and standard operating procedures (SOPs) on a quarterly basis to ensure consistency, compliance, and alignment with evolving business needs.
  • Participate in and support special projects and ad-hoc requests as directed by management.
